Parker Hornet with mahogany body and carved maple top refinished in nitrocellulose lacquer. The bridge humbucker was rewound to vintage specs (original neck pickup sounds great). Pushpull pots have been replaced.

Tomas - this Parker Hornet also has an ebony fretboard and the humbuckers are AlNiCo 5s. The neck pickup was excellent in the 7.9k range, but the bridge was overwound (13.4k) and too midrangy. I agree with you about the AlNiCo IIs, once you get used to single coils, they tend to be uneventful and lacking in the treble end.

Custom build relic SG style in a Pelham Blue nitrocellulose lacquer finish. Mahogany body hand beveled. Neck back was sourced and a rosewood fingerboard was glued in. Medium jumbo fretwire. 24.7 Inch scale. 16 inch radius. Pickups feature an AlNiCo V in neck with an Alnico II in the bridge. Headstock features an inlayed sterling silver cross over Zebrawood cap. Resonant and warm sound, this one really sings.

Here are some pics of one of my blanca flamenco guitars without the tap plate and traditional pegs. Note the spine that runs the center of the Honduran mahogany neck right up underneath the rosewood fingerboard, providing strength and keeping the neck from bowing or warping. The top is a select piece of spruce with narrow straight grain. The back and sides are solid cypress with wood binding. Really low action and plays like an electric.

Lake Placid Blue lightly reliced with nitro finish. I use a simulated plastercast for my base coat lending a vintage look when the lacquer is worn. The neck pickup is from a vintage 1970 guitar. Low impedance, but sounds great.
